Vehicle in police ambulance bureau strikes pedestrian
A Nassau police ambulance bureau vehicle struck and injured a pedestrian in Hempstead Thursday night, officials said.
The male pedestrian was struck near the intersection of Clinton Street and Lent Avenue about 9:45 p.m., Nassau police said.
The injured man was taken to a hospital for treatment, police said, but information concerning his condition and identity was not immediately released.
